Key Responsibilities:

  • Take responsibility for the cost management of projects from inception to completion.

     

  • Prepare accurate cost estimates and financial reports for ongoing projects.

     

  • Value work done and submit accurate applications for payment to clients.

     

  • Procure subcontractors and suppliers and manage subcontractor payments and variations.

     

  • Monitor project budgets and ensure all costs are kept within the agreed limits.

     

  • Attend site visits as necessary and liaise with the project team to resolve any commercial issues that arise.

     

  • Work closely with the Commercial Manager to ensure smooth operation and successful delivery of projects.

     

  • Develop relationships with key stakeholders, including the main clients, subcontractors, and suppliers.

     

  • Ensure compliance with all contractual obligations, standards, and company procedures.

     

  • Assist with the preparation of tender documents and support in the negotiation of contracts.
